Output 866f84ef869bc5403698bcaf8ddabd6224affd9fa26d35c5c807ff3f8a717ccd:0

value
322489861
script pubkey
OP_0 OP_PUSHBYTES_20 15f8c449962424db9ad1c952e9dd71c7a40704ca
address
ltc1qzhuvgjvkysjdhxk3e9fwnht3c7jqwpx20e0p2z
transaction
866f84ef869bc5403698bcaf8ddabd6224affd9fa26d35c5c807ff3f8a717ccd
spent
true